Activate on-screen display (OSD) by pressing either of the keyboard Control
keys twice within one second. In non-secure mode, this brings up the main
OSD Window, “Administrator Channel List”.
In secure mode, activating OSD will bring up the “User Login” window. Type
in your user name and press Enter. The system administrator should login
as “Admin”, “Root” or “Administrator”. Type your password and press Enter.
This will bring up your “Channel List”. If there is no keyboard activity, the
login window will timeout after five minutes and go blank to allow the
monitor’s energy saver to execute. Enter your OSD activation sequence to
restore the login prompt.
Note: All AutoView 424 units ship in the default non-secure state. For more
information on secure versus non-secure operation, see the section
‘Administrator Functions’.
